Eagle Rock came tearing into Wednesday's matchup with six straight wins (a stretch where they outscored their opponents by an average of 4 goals), and they left with even more momentum. They never let the Franklin Panthers get on the board and left with a 2-0 win. That's two games straight that Eagle Rock have won by exactly two goals.
Max Otto was the driving force of Eagle Rock's attack as he scored both of Eagle Rock's goals, bringing his season total up to three goals.
Eagle Rock's victory bumped their record up to 7-2-1. As for Franklin, their loss was their third straight at home, which dropped their record down to 3-5-2.
We've got plenty of inter-league action coming up soon. Eagle Rock is set to face off against their familiar foe Marshall at 2:30 p.m. on Friday. Meanwhile, Franklin will challenge rival Bravo at 4:30 p.m. on Friday.
